bfs: bfs (breadth-first version of the UNIX find command)
bfs:
bfs: bfs is a variant of the UNIX find command that operates breadth-first
bfs: rather than depth-first, typically locating files faster by listing
bfs: shallower paths before descending into deeper subtrees. It is mostly
bfs: compatible with POSIX, GNU, FreeBSD, OpenBSD, NetBSD, and macOS find,
bfs: and adds quality-of-life improvements like colored output, helpful
bfs: error messages, and operators such as -exclude and -hidden.
